Pursuant to the Vermont Public Records Act, I hereby request the following records:

1) Any training materials, reading materials, textbooks, lecture notes, presentation slides, course syllabi, curricula, program schedules, or any other educational materials received by VSP regarding the ADL's leadership seminar in Israel. For reference, a news article describing the seminar and VSP's withdrawl from it is available here: https://forward.com/news/415742/new-england-police-pull-out-of-training-program-in-israel/.

2) Any marketing or planning materials received by VSP from the ADL, describing the content and scheduling of the seminar.

I am writing regarding your public records request, received December 13, 2018 and addressed to the Vermont State Police ("VSP") PRA Office, for the following:

1. Any training materials, reading materials, textbooks, lecture notes, presentation slides, course syllabi, curricula, program schedules, or any other educational materials received by VSP regarding the ADL's leadership seminar in Israel;

2. Any marketing or planning materials received by VSP from the ADL, describing the content and scheduling of the seminar.

The records attached here constitute all of the records that have been identified for release in response to your request under Vermont's Public Records Act. These records include:

a. Email from Robert O. Trestan, Regional Director, ADL, to Col. Matthew Birmingham, Director, VSP, dated November 20, 2018;

b. Document entitled Take-aways from the Leadership Seminar in Israel: Resiliency and Counterterrorism, sent as an attachment to the email described in item 'a';

c. Letter from Robert O. Trestan and Talia Ben Sasson-Gordis, Sr. Associate Regional Director, ADL to Col. Matthew Birmingham, dated June 27, 2018.
